The patient showed extensive cervical lymph node metastasis, more on the left than on the right, cervically on both sides. A gross needle biopsy of the cervical lymph node metastasis on the left side revealed infiltration by a squamous cell carcinoma. After an unremarkable panendoscopy, a PET-CT was performed, which showed bilateral enhancement in the tonsil region on both sides, which is why a tumor tonsillectomy was indicated.
